Output 2cf8b5361b171f043124f6f966d829ae3d1f89a220ce37b1764b1d4b06a43ac0:1

value
581876587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c8cfe3524ee13f4d5b9308492ab622a4bd992a OP_EQUAL
address
MCFpZ7W7iGz4PbVJAC3RVLQybhpX5CwLE2
transaction
2cf8b5361b171f043124f6f966d829ae3d1f89a220ce37b1764b1d4b06a43ac0
spent
true